Starting January 1, 2009 inpatient and outpatient accredited facilities will need to abide by the new Risk Management provisions of The Joint Commission Environment of Care standard. This new standard specifically cites Sentinel Event Alerts as one external reference that must be considered in defining risks. For MRI facilities, this automatically means Sentinel Event Alert #38
